Value the engine, not the fuel tank.
01
Split the profit before you cheer it. Revenue from operations and other income sit on two separate lines in every results filing. Read the first one before you celebrate the bottom one.
02
A rising other-income share is a tell. When the treasury desk is outgrowing the actual business, the core is stalling and the cash pile is quietly doing the lifting the product used to do.
03
A one-off asset sale is not next year's profit, and interest on a cash pile is not the business you are buying. Both spend the same. Neither tells you the company got better at its job.
You are buying the factory, not the fixed deposit. Read the line that tells you which one is actually making the money.
